The leaders of the United States, Japan, India and Australia will meet in a virtual summit Friday 12 March 2021, the US and Indian governments announced.
It will be the first time talks have been held between the heads of state of the four-member group, informally known as the "Quad," and comes as all four countries see heightened tensions with China over a variety of issues.
